版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)
文檔簡介
2025年華為技術(shù)公司招聘面試模擬題計算機科學與技術(shù)專業(yè)#2025年華為技術(shù)公司招聘面試模擬題(計算機科學與技術(shù)專業(yè))一、選擇題(共5題,每題2分,總分10分)1.關(guān)于數(shù)據(jù)結(jié)構(gòu)的選擇在需要頻繁插入和刪除操作的場景下,以下哪種數(shù)據(jù)結(jié)構(gòu)的時間復雜度最優(yōu)?A.數(shù)組B.鏈表C.堆D.哈希表2.算法復雜度分析以下哪個算法的平均時間復雜度為O(nlogn)?A.冒泡排序B.選擇排序C.快速排序D.插入排序3.操作系統(tǒng)概念在多道程序系統(tǒng)中,采用分時系統(tǒng)的主要目的是什么?A.提高CPU利用率B.增加內(nèi)存容量C.減少磁盤訪問時間D.提升網(wǎng)絡傳輸速率4.計算機網(wǎng)絡協(xié)議以下哪個協(xié)議用于電子郵件傳輸?A.FTPB.SMTPC.HTTPD.TCP5.數(shù)據(jù)庫系統(tǒng)以下哪種數(shù)據(jù)庫模型支持復雜查詢和事務處理?A.層次模型B.網(wǎng)狀模型C.關(guān)系模型D.文件模型二、填空題(共5題,每題2分,總分10分)1.在二叉搜索樹中,任何節(jié)點的左子樹只包含小于該節(jié)點的值,右子樹只包含大于該節(jié)點的值,這一特性稱為__________。2.在TCP/IP協(xié)議棧中,傳輸層的主要協(xié)議是__________和UDP。3.SQL中用于刪除表的語句是__________。4.算法的時間復雜度表示算法執(zhí)行時間隨輸入規(guī)模增長的變化趨勢,常用的表示方法有__________、__________和__________。5.在面向?qū)ο缶幊讨校庋b、繼承和多態(tài)是三大基本原則,其中__________原則確保了類的內(nèi)部實現(xiàn)細節(jié)對外的隱藏。三、簡答題(共5題,每題4分,總分20分)1.簡述快速排序的基本思想及其工作過程。2.解釋什么是內(nèi)存分頁,及其優(yōu)缺點。3.說明HTTP和HTTPS協(xié)議的主要區(qū)別。4.什么是數(shù)據(jù)庫的范式?簡述第一范式(1NF)的要求。5.描述TCP協(xié)議的三次握手過程及其必要性。四、編程題(共3題,每題10分,總分30分)1.實現(xiàn)一個簡單的二叉搜索樹(BST),包含插入和查找功能。(要求:使用Python或C++實現(xiàn),展示核心代碼邏輯)2.編寫一個函數(shù),判斷一個字符串是否為回文。(要求:不使用庫函數(shù),展示核心算法思路)3.設計一個算法,找出數(shù)組中重復次數(shù)超過一半的元素。(要求:時間復雜度為O(n),空間復雜度為O(1))五、綜合題(共2題,每題15分,總分30分)1.設計一個簡單的學生管理系統(tǒng),要求實現(xiàn)以下功能:-添加學生信息(姓名、學號、成績)-刪除學生信息-查詢學生信息-修改學生成績(要求:說明數(shù)據(jù)結(jié)構(gòu)設計及核心代碼邏輯)2.假設你要設計一個分布式緩存系統(tǒng),請簡述其關(guān)鍵設計要點及可能的挑戰(zhàn)。(要求:包括數(shù)據(jù)一致性、高可用性、負載均衡等方面的考慮)答案部分一、選擇題答案1.B(鏈表)2.C(快速排序)3.A(提高CPU利用率)4.B(SMTP)5.C(關(guān)系模型)二、填空題答案1.二叉搜索性2.TCP3.DROPTABLE4.大O表示法、大Ω表示法、大Θ表示法5.封裝三、簡答題答案1.快速排序的基本思想:通過一個基準值將數(shù)組分成兩個子數(shù)組,左邊的元素都小于基準值,右邊的元素都大于基準值,然后遞歸地對這兩個子數(shù)組進行快速排序。工作過程:-選擇基準值(通常為第一個或最后一個元素)-分區(qū)操作,將數(shù)組重新排列,使得基準值左邊的元素都小于它,右邊的元素都大于它-對左右兩個子數(shù)組遞歸執(zhí)行上述步驟2.內(nèi)存分頁:將物理內(nèi)存和邏輯內(nèi)存分割成固定大小的塊(頁),通過頁表進行映射。優(yōu)點:-提高內(nèi)存利用率,允許部分裝入-防止用戶進程互相干擾缺點:-增加內(nèi)存碎片-頁表查找開銷3.HTTP和HTTPS的區(qū)別:-HTTP是明文傳輸,數(shù)據(jù)易被竊取;HTTPS通過SSL/TLS加密傳輸,更安全-HTTPS需要證書驗證,HTTP不需要-HTTPS的端口為443,HTTP為804.數(shù)據(jù)庫范式:規(guī)范化理論將關(guān)系數(shù)據(jù)庫分為若干范式,以減少數(shù)據(jù)冗余和提高數(shù)據(jù)一致性。第一范式(1NF)要求:-表中的每一列都是原子列,不可再分-每一行唯一標識5.TCP三次握手:-客戶端發(fā)送SYN包,進入SYN_SENT狀態(tài)-服務器回復SYN+ACK包,進入SYN_RCVD狀態(tài)-客戶端發(fā)送ACK包,進入ESTABLISHED狀態(tài)必要性:確保雙方都準備好通信,防止歷史連接請求導致的問題四、編程題答案1.二叉搜索樹實現(xiàn)(Python示例):pythonclassTreeNode:def__init__(self,key):self.left=Noneself.right=Noneself.val=keyclassBST:definsert(self,root,key):ifrootisNone:returnTreeNode(key)ifkey<root.val:root.left=self.insert(root.left,key)else:root.right=self.insert(root.right,key)returnrootdefsearch(self,root,key):ifrootisNoneorroot.val==key:returnrootifkey<root.val:returnself.search(root.left,key)returnself.search(root.right,key)2.回文判斷(Python示例):pythondefis_palindrome(s):left,right=0,len(s)-1whileleft<right:ifs[left]!=s[right]:returnFalseleft+=1right-=1returnTrue3.找重復元素(Python示例):pythondefmajority_element(nums):count=0candidate=Nonefornuminnums:ifcount==0:candidate=numcount+=(1ifnum==candidateelse-1)returncandidate五、綜合題答案1.學生管理系統(tǒng)設計:數(shù)據(jù)結(jié)構(gòu):-學生信息:`{name:str,id:str,score:float}`-數(shù)據(jù)存儲:使用字典`{id:{name,score}}`核心代碼邏輯:pythonclassStudentSystem:def__init__(self):self.students={}defadd_student(self,name,id,score):self.students[id]={'name':name,'score':score}defdelete_student(self,id):ifidinself.students:delself.students[id]defquery_student(self,id):returnself.students.get(id,None)defupdate_score(self,id,score):ifidinself.students
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
- 6. 下載文件中如有侵權(quán)或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 資產(chǎn)內(nèi)部審計制度
- 街舞考級制度
- 藍天救援隊值班制度
- 用日語介紹常德
- 2026浙江溫州市洞頭捷鹿船務有限公司招聘1人(售票員)備考考試試題附答案解析
- 輔警刑法考試試題及答案
- 2026中國科學院生物物理研究所生物成像中心工程師助理招聘2人備考考試試題附答案解析
- 2026廣東南粵銀行總行部門分行相關(guān)崗位招聘備考考試試題附答案解析
- 企業(yè)網(wǎng)Windows應用服務構(gòu)建項目實訓報告(樣例)
- 2026年濱州無棣縣事業(yè)單位公開招聘人員備考考試題庫附答案解析
- 2024年山東省高考數(shù)學閱卷情況反饋
- 《老年高血壓的用藥指導 》 教學課件
- 建筑消防設施檢測投標方案
- 《ISO∕IEC 42001-2023信息技術(shù)-人工智能-管理體系》解讀和應用指導材料(雷澤佳2024A0)
- 國內(nèi)外無功補償研發(fā)現(xiàn)狀與發(fā)展趨勢
- 不動產(chǎn)買賣合同完整版doc(兩篇)2024
- 風光儲多能互補微電網(wǎng)
- 倫理學全套課件
- 婦科急腹癥的識別與緊急處理
- 貴州醫(yī)科大學
- 散貨船水尺計量和方法-計算表
評論
0/150
提交評論